Just FYI In the F150 on the sync 3 with Forscan you can change the speaker outs to line level and turn on the sub output if it didnā€™t come with factory sub. Im sure the bronco will have similar capabilities If you decide the stock system isnā€™t enough.

When riding topless, you may have to go to great length to get it sounding good. I can hear my music plenty in my jeep w/ the top down, doors off, 35ā€ MT tires. I added speaker baffles for the dash speakers, polyfill in rollbar rear pod enclosures, downfiring sub in a sealed custom enclosure, aftermarket front/rear speaker upgrades and a 5ch amp years ago.

wont be doing it on the wifeā€™s B&O system in the Bronco though.

Funny timing on this post. I was just sitting here in CAD figuring out what I can reasonably fit in the back of a 2-door based on the 3D imaging dimensions that were posted on here earlier this week. I typically run Sundown or CT Sounds subs. I hate to give up too much space so I'm thinking about either (3) 8's or a single 12 in a ported box ~1.5ft3. I can probably fit the (3) 8's easier and they would sound awesome on 95% of the music I listen to but they can't play low as loud. I asked the guy at the Bronco show recently what the capacity of the alternator was and he didn't know. A Taramps 3000.1 will draw ~120A so I'm hoping the alternator is at least in that range. I have a single 12 in my TJ and it does pretty well even with the top off but as with anything I'd like to have a little more output. Regarding the under seat subs, I had a buddy that put them in a TJ and they added more bass than stock but had zero capacity to play lower than "mid-bass". If you've ever heard someone replace the OEM 6.5" sub in a TJ console it was kind of the same thing. You could tell it was better than stock but IMHO not enough difference to warrant the time and $$. I have heard some systems with multiple Sundown X65 / SA65s and they are pretty impressive for small drivers so maybe in the right Bronco setup they would be adequate.
